Juventus move ten points clear at summit

Juventus moved ten points clear at the Serie A summit as Carlos Tévez, Leonardo Bonucci and Álvaro Morata helped see off AC Milan 3-1, while Torino FC won at Hellas Verona FC.

• Serie A leaders Juventus record 3-1 success against struggling AC Milan.
• Carlos Tévez, Leonardo Bonucci and Álvaro Morata register for champions in home victory.
• Hosts record ninth victory in 11 league outings at home.
• Juve ten points clear at summit, having played a game more than second-placed AS Roma.

• Seventh-placed Torino FC triumph 3-1 at Hellas Verona FC.
• Josef Martínez, Fabio Quagliarella and Omar El Kaddouri on target for visitors.
• Torino earn fourth consecutive victory; Granata unbeaten in nine league outings this term.
